Fees and Financial Aid

The fees structure for BSC AGRICULTURE HONS is nearly 50000 - 60000 per year. For SC,ST Categories there is reduction in sem fees and hostel fees. The fees should be pay semester wise and hostel and mess fees should pay monthly it's nearly 4000 per month. The college is providing merit scholarship for Karnataka students and Students from other states will get ICAR merit scholarship based on the CGPA.The CGPA Should be more than 7. Admission

After 12th, I wrote ICAR entrance exam through the Central portal. I got admission in in University of agricultural sciences, Dharwad is actually very good and we are getting good opportunities and experiences from here and we are interested with so many pros and many students, different different states, so it is very beneficial and the cut-off of the exam is like previously it was conducted by ICAR. Now the admission procedure is through CUET. THE CUET Rank REQUIRED FOR THIS COLLEGE is 2000-, 8000 WE WILL GET ADMISSION HERE

That exam pattern is semester wise, and mid semester wise , The external exam is for 50 marks and the internal mark is for 50 mark. in internal exam, there will be practical exam also. This course provide so many subjects like agriculture, culture, fisheries, forestry, pathology, entomology, environmental science ,statistics, genetics ,plant breeding , microbiology , agriculture engineering there are so many subjects are included in this course.
